Grass Valley's own Bodhi DuLac once aspired to one thing only: to be the world’s greatest heavy metal guitarist. When he met Jesus Christ, his dream changed. Now, he says, he was created to worship, and that is what he intends to do. Rock star dreams have transformed into a passion for the lost and conflicted youth of today. Still a rocker at heart, he has expanded his repertoire to include a wider (but still cool!) musical range that remains edgy and clearly reflects being totally sold out for Christ. Today’s youth desperately need something worth living for, he says, and that something is the Lord. Through the universal language of music, he is able to reach out to a hurting generation of young people. Bodhi recently released an EP entitled "Travelin' Shoes," which showcases three of his most recent all-original songs, all written, arranged and sung by Bodhi and his band. Currently, he is in the studio working to complete a full-length as-of-yet-untitled CD. In the process of expanding his ministry, Bodhi desires to reach young people with the gospel message, and to do it with his music....

Currently, Bodhi serves as the primary worship leader for Word-A-Live Family Church in Penn Valley, where he served as youth leader with his wife Amanda for several years. He leads worship for AUXANO, a college-age group that meets at Solid Rock church on the last Sunday of the month, and can often be found leading worship for InnerState Youth Ministries, a community youth ministry that meets weekly at the same church. He also may be found at his home church’s youth group A.R.M.Y., facilitating worship, sharing his passion for music, and encouraging the teens to seek the Lord in all things.
